Mobile fueling is a service that brings liquid fuel directly to vehicles, machines, or generators at their location using specialized delivery trucks or portable tanks—think of it like on-demand fuel delivery similar to a food delivery service for gas and diesel. It matters to investors because it can create steady, recurring revenue, reduce downtime for customers, lower operating costs, and expose a company to regulatory and environmental risks that affect profitability.

Fuel deliveries to approximately 20 generators are expected to continue through mid-July

MIAMI, FL, June 24,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- NextNRG, Inc. (NASDAQ: NXXT), a pioneer in AI-driven energy innovation, transforming how energy is produced, managed, and delivered, today announced that its mobile fueling platform, EzFill, is providing on-site fuel delivery services supporting generator operations at a once-in-four-years global soccer tournament currently underway in Miami. EzFill expects to deliver more than 50,000 gallons of fuel in total to power temporary generator infrastructure at the venue.

EzFill has already delivered approximately 25,000 gallons to date, fueling approximately 20 generators on-site, with an additional 25,000 gallons expected to be delivered through mid-July as the tournament concludes.

"Supporting a global soccer tournament of this scale requires dependable infrastructure behind the scenes, and fuel is a critical part of that equation," said Michael D. Farkas, Founder and CEO of NextNRG. "Our team is proud to help keep temporary generator infrastructure operating throughout the event. Delivering fuel where and when it is needed is what we do every day, and this project demonstrates our ability to perform when reliability is essential."

This engagement highlights the broad range of applications for EzFill's mobile fueling platform. In addition to commercial fleets, on-site fuel delivery can support large-scale events, temporary power infrastructure, construction operations, backup generation, data center backup power applications and other mission-critical operations.

EzFill operates one of the nation's largest on-demand mobile fueling fleets, delivering directly to vehicles, generators, and equipment at commercial and industrial sites across the country.
